Istanbul, Turkey
  • Resident population: 12,569,041 Annual visitors: 3,994,000 (est.)
  • Major features: mosques, Turkish baths, palaces, nightlife, bazaars
  • 26,037 TripAdvisor reviews of 748 accommodations, 149 attractions and 863 restaurants
Historic and modern, European and Asian — that's Istanbul. The city at the junction of two continents is home to ancient structures like the Hagia Sophia and the Blue Mosque in the Old City, as well as modern businesses, hotels, restaurants and nightlife in the New City.
Riviera Maya, Mexico
  • Resident population: 125,000 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, water sports, archaeological tours
  • 71,898 TripAdvisor reviews of 1,037 accommodations, 117 attractions and 310 restaurants
The Mayan Riviera, Mexico's Caribbean coastline, is more than just the resort town of Playa del Carmen. Stretching from the fishing village of Puerto Morales to the biosphere reserve of Sian Ka'an, the area offers visitors a plethora of both eco-tourism and luxury destinations.
Grand Cayman, Caribbean
  • Resident population: 37,083 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, Stingray City, water sports
  • 6,024 TripAdvisor reviews of 157 accommodations, 160 attractions and 152 restaurants
Grand Cayman's splashier side is the real draw. Offering a host of experiences, from petting attention- and food-seeking stingrays at Stingray City to exploring jaw-dropping drop-offs and dive sites, Grand Cayman is a watery wonderland.
